Staples to Buy in Bulk and Save

There are certain food staples you can purchase in bulk when they are on sale or just because they are cheaper in larger quantities. In other words, some food items last longer than others. It’s not a bad idea to have a store of food that you can count on being there if you suddenly loose income or if the weather becomes too harsh to get out of your house.

1. Canned Beans - There are a large variety of canned beans to choose from. Always choose types of beans that you enjoy eating, not ones just because they are on sale. Shelf life for canned beans is 1 year. In fact, any kind of canned goods store for a long time.

2. Stock/broth - Canned chicken, beef or vegetable stock also has a shelf life of 1 year. You can throw in a lot of leftover meat and vegetables into broth and make stews and soup, which is always good on a cold day.

3. Rice - A basic staple, rice is great to throw into that soup you were making from the broth. It’s shelf life is 1 year.

4. Water - No matter where you live, it’s a good practice to keep bottled water on hand. Rotate it so you are using the oldest bottle.

Keep your stored foods in tightly sealed containers in a cool location for the longest shelf life.
